How to Stay Sane in an Age of Division is a compact, pocket-book about how our world feels increasingly fractured — and what mindset might help us not just cope, but think and live more wisely. Elif Shafak reminds us that being sane in a divided time isn’t about tuned-out calm, but curious engagement.

Elif Shafak doesn’t preach or promise magical life hacks; instead, she guides the reader through our social and political landscape with genuine curiosity and a generous spirit. One of the most striking ideas in the book is how stories connect us. Shafak writes, “The moment we stop listening to diverse opinions is also when we stop learning.” This reflects a core theme of her book: that wisdom does not come from the echo chambers of social media, but from a diversity of voices and experiences. Another powerful observation is, “We live in an age in which there is too much information, less knowledge and even less wisdom.” Here, Shafak challenges readers to move beyond simply scrolling through headlines and instead read, reflect, and understand rather than react. This idea feels especially relevant today, as it is easy to become overwhelmed by the constant flow of information. What is far more difficult is slowing down and truly empathizing with people who are different from us. Overall, the book encourages readers to rethink ideas of identity and belonging, and to reflect on how emotions can empower us without becoming all-consuming — particularly in an age marked by division.

2.5 - this would have been so much better if I hadn't already listened to the interviews with Elif Shafak available for free on Spotify. The content is pretty much exactly the same, often even verbatim. The thoughts are worth listening to (or reading about), but I could have just saved the money I spent on the hard copy.
